Analysis

The most recent figure for external health expenditure in Vanuatu is 32.0%, measured in 2023.

That represents a change of down 34.5% on the previous year and down 18.0% over ten years.

Over the whole period, external health expenditure in Vanuatu peaked at 71.8% in 2014 and was at its lowest, 14.8%, in 2001.

That places Vanuatu 20th out of 177 countries with data for 2023, putting it in the top quarter.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 24 years of available data.

External health expenditure in Vanuatu, year by year

Annual values for External health expenditure (% of current health expenditure) in Vanuatu, 2000 to 2023.
Year % of current health expenditure Change
2000 14.9%
2001 14.8% -0.6%
2002 23.9% +61.5%
2003 15.8% -33.9%
2004 21.5% +35.6%
2005 21.8% +1.6%
2006 22.9% +5.0%
2007 15.6% -32.0%
2008 15.2% -2.3%
2009 26.2% +71.8%
2010 32.9% +25.6%
2011 22.8% -30.7%
2012 30.6% +34.4%
2013 39.0% +27.4%
2014 71.8% +84.3%
2015 41.0% -42.9%
2016 42.5% +3.7%
2017 34.8% -18.2%
2018 26.5% -23.8%
2019 35.1% +32.4%
2020 26.1% -25.6%
2021 62.5% +139.3%
2022 48.8% -21.9%
2023 32.0% -34.5%

Share of current health expenditures funded from external sources. External sources compose of direct foreign transfers and foreign transfers distributed by government encompassing all financial inflows into the national health system from outside the country. External sources either flow through the government scheme or are channeled through non-governmental organizations or other schemes.
